Senior DevOps Engineer

Description:

The Senior DevOps Engineer will be responsible for deployment/installation, configuration, performance, tuning and maintenance including fault tolerance, clustering and stability of ROR and PHP application servers and other software products and proprietary applications.

This person will troubleshoot application issues and support the application development cycle involved with application design, deploying code and resolving any infrastructure problems. Other duties include: monitoring production environment, tuning ROR/PHP application servers to optimize performance, reinstalling all middle-tier products, participating in production problem calls, stabilizing and improving performance both in the application layer as well as the database layer.

Duties and Responsibilities:

  • Administrator for the installation, configuration, performance, tuning and maintenance of ROR/PHP application servers on Linux platforms.
  • Troubleshoot application issues and support the application development cycle involved with application design, deploying code, and resolving any infrastructure problems.
  • Automation of cloud based deployments.
  • Monitoring production environment, tuning application servers to optimize performance, reinstalling all Middleware products during lease replacements, participating in production problem calls, stabilizing and improving performance.
  • Assist with day to day management of a Production web application environment based on Linux and open source technologies.
  • Use best practices to setup and maintain a secure computing environment.

Required Skills and Abilities:

  • Experience managing production deployments.
  • Experience in managing Continuous Integration/Continuous Development environments.
  • 3+ years of experience in Apache, PHP and ROR environments.
  • Has worked with provisioning tools like Chef, Puppet or similar.
  • Proven experience with Linux system administration.
  • Proven experience developing and managing high-bandwidth video and other multi-media environments.
  • Proven experience in deploying and managing applications on the cloud (AWS or similar).
  • 3+ years of experience with supporting Linux in a production web environment.
  • Be a technical “Jack of all trades”.
  • Excellent communication, problem solving and organizational skills.
  • BA/BS or equivalent experience.
  • Experience working in a fast-paced, early-stage company.